    Miglia is on the Mac-friendly TV tuner warpath again, busting out yet another option to add PVR functionality to your shiny new MacBook Pro. The TVDuo is aimed squarely at our UK allies as it sports dual DVB-T tuners, a very portable 3.9- x 2.7- x 1.11-inch enclosure, and USB 2.0 connectivity. Elgato's EyeTV 2 software comes bundled in, and enables recording / editing functionality, a nifty "export to iPod" option, and even plays nice with iDVD. The device also comes partnered with a ho hum remote and two "mini antennas" that can operate in diversity mode. No word, however, on eventual pricing nor when the TVDuo will hit store shelves.     Miglia announced today the first dual digital TV tuner for the Mac, called TVDuo. TVDuo let's you watch one television program while you record another one, or use picture in picture. Elgato's EyeTV 2 is included with the TVDuo.Sadly, for Americans like me, the TVDuo will only work with over the air signals in most European and Asian countries.
